fre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

c課程設(shè)計(jì)-圖書館管理系統(tǒng)報(bào)告書-wenkub

2022-09-16 11:32:05 本頁面
 

【正文】 。若干個(gè)數(shù)據(jù)項(xiàng)的有意義的集合,包括名稱、含義以 及組成數(shù)據(jù)結(jié)構(gòu)的數(shù)據(jù)項(xiàng)。調(diào)查應(yīng)用系統(tǒng)用戶要求對(duì)數(shù)據(jù)庫進(jìn)行什么樣的處理,理清數(shù)據(jù)庫中各種數(shù)據(jù)之間的關(guān)系。在這個(gè)階段主要工作是收集基本數(shù)據(jù)以及數(shù)據(jù)處理的流程,為以后進(jìn)一步設(shè)計(jì)一打下基礎(chǔ)。數(shù)據(jù)庫結(jié)構(gòu)設(shè)計(jì)主要就是要設(shè)計(jì)好數(shù)據(jù)庫中各個(gè)表的結(jié)構(gòu),包括信息保存在哪些表格中、各個(gè)表的結(jié)構(gòu)如何以及各個(gè)表之間的關(guān)系。 系統(tǒng)功能模塊設(shè)計(jì) 本系統(tǒng)分為普通用戶 (讀者)和管理員,普通用戶的職能模塊包括查詢圖書、 借閱圖書 和查詢已借圖書信息 ,管理 員 職能模塊包括用戶管理、圖書管理、借閱管理、登錄管理,得到如圖系統(tǒng)功能模塊: 基于 C的圖書館管理系統(tǒng) 進(jìn) 入 圖 書 館 管 理 系 統(tǒng)管 理 員 用 戶登 錄查 詢 圖 書 借 閱 圖 書圖 書 管 理用 戶 管 理 圖 書 管 理 借 閱 管 理 登 陸 管 理瀏覽用戶添加用戶瀏覽圖書查找圖書個(gè)人借閱查詢書庫借出查詢重新登錄修改密碼成 功失 敗 第三章 數(shù)據(jù)庫設(shè)計(jì) 當(dāng)然數(shù)據(jù)通過中間層的中轉(zhuǎn)無疑是降低了效率,但是它脫離于界面與數(shù)據(jù)庫的完美封裝,使得它的缺點(diǎn)顯然不值得一提。 ( 3) 系統(tǒng)采用 C/S 體系結(jié)構(gòu), Cli(客戶端 )負(fù)責(zé)提供表達(dá)邏輯、顯示用戶界面信息、訪問數(shù)據(jù)庫服務(wù)器 。 根據(jù)圖書館日常圖書管理工作的需求和圖書借閱的管理流程,該系統(tǒng)實(shí)施后,應(yīng)該達(dá)到以下目標(biāo): 1. 充分了解用戶需求及當(dāng)前形式,功能齊備,能完成圖書處理; 2. 要有詳細(xì)的設(shè)計(jì)說明書; 3. 每一模塊的流程圖要很清晰; 4. 系統(tǒng)能夠正常的運(yùn)行,能較好的完成預(yù)定的功能; 5. 系統(tǒng)要有完整的幫助文件,供前臺(tái)操作員能方便的操作本系統(tǒng)。 系統(tǒng)采用 先 進(jìn)的 兩 層體系結(jié)構(gòu), Client(客戶 端 )負(fù)責(zé)提供表達(dá)邏輯、顯示用戶界面信息、基本操作 ; Server(服務(wù)器 端 )負(fù)責(zé) 實(shí)現(xiàn)數(shù)據(jù)服務(wù)。利用 SQL Server 2020 創(chuàng)建圖書館管理各信息表 —— 用戶信息表、圖書信息表 。 目前社會(huì)上信息管理系統(tǒng)發(fā)展飛快 , 各個(gè)企事業(yè)單位都引入了信基于 C的圖書館管理系統(tǒng) 息管理軟件來管理自己日益增長的各種信息 ,圖書管理系統(tǒng)也是有了很大的發(fā)展 , 商業(yè)化的圖書信息管理軟件也不少 。 由于 C采用了類似于 Visual Basic 的較易使用的程序設(shè)計(jì)界面,從而成為了一種 更加簡單易學(xué)、功能強(qiáng)大的應(yīng)用程序開發(fā)工具。 前言部分論述了圖書館系統(tǒng)的發(fā)展以及圖書館用計(jì)算機(jī)自動(dòng)化管理的前景。在邁 入二十一世紀(jì)的今天,對(duì)圖書館的管理顯得極其重要,合理的管理不但反映了一個(gè)國家的科技水平,而且影響人們對(duì)知識(shí)掌握的速度和質(zhì)量。在知識(shí)經(jīng)濟(jì)時(shí)代到來的今天,用計(jì)算機(jī)管理圖書館的工作由自動(dòng)化系統(tǒng)運(yùn)行而完成。 正文論述了圖書館管理系統(tǒng)的特點(diǎn)及圖書館自動(dòng)化管理的重要性和圖書館 管理系統(tǒng)軟件需要實(shí)現(xiàn)的主要功能,分析圖書館管理系統(tǒng)以及實(shí)現(xiàn)軟件開發(fā)的系統(tǒng)要求,簡述了實(shí)現(xiàn)圖書館管理系統(tǒng)設(shè)計(jì)需要,圖書館系統(tǒng)數(shù)據(jù)庫的設(shè)計(jì),程序流程圖以及詳細(xì)設(shè)計(jì),并陳列了改系統(tǒng)開發(fā)所應(yīng)用的主要參考文獻(xiàn)。 C是一種先進(jìn)的、面向?qū)ο蟮恼Z言,使用 C語言可以讓開發(fā)人員快速的建立大范圍的基于 MS 網(wǎng)絡(luò)平臺(tái)的應(yīng)用,并且提供大量的開發(fā)工具和服務(wù),幫助開發(fā)人員開發(fā)機(jī)基于計(jì)算和通信的各種應(yīng)用。 開發(fā)背景 圖書館在正常運(yùn)營中面對(duì)大量書籍、讀者信息以及兩者間相互聯(lián)系產(chǎn)生的借書信息、還書信息。 但本系統(tǒng)完全獨(dú)立開發(fā) , 力求使系統(tǒng)功能簡潔明了 , 但功能齊全且易于操作。利用 C和數(shù)據(jù)庫建立連接之后,利用 C中的控件按鈕以及一些程序代碼實(shí)現(xiàn)一些特定的功能,例如用戶圖書信息查詢、書庫借出查詢、密碼修改、查找圖書、個(gè)人信息查詢、添加用戶等,極大地提高了圖書館管理的效率。 問題的提出: 為了減少人工工作量,提高工作效率,使圖書館管理員 的工作更加有效地進(jìn)行。 6. 系統(tǒng)應(yīng)該具備管理用戶的信息,對(duì)用戶的信息進(jìn)行管理,實(shí)現(xiàn)用戶圖書的借閱功能。Server(服務(wù)器端 )則用于提基于 C的圖書館管理系統(tǒng) 供數(shù)據(jù)服務(wù)。 典型的三層結(jié)構(gòu)分為表示( presentation)層 , 領(lǐng)域( domain)層 , 以及基礎(chǔ)架構(gòu)( infrastructure)層,而微軟的 DNA 架構(gòu)定義了三個(gè)層:表示層( presentation),業(yè)務(wù)層( business),和數(shù)據(jù)存儲(chǔ)層( data access) 。 引入背景 圖書館管理 系統(tǒng)是一個(gè)數(shù)據(jù)庫應(yīng)用系統(tǒng),用戶及圖書的所有信息都保存在數(shù)據(jù)庫中。由于數(shù)據(jù)庫設(shè)計(jì)的重要性,人們提出了許多數(shù)據(jù)庫結(jié)構(gòu)設(shè)計(jì)的技術(shù)。需求分析主要解決兩個(gè)問題: (1)內(nèi)容要求。 在數(shù)據(jù)庫需求分析后,得到一個(gè)數(shù)據(jù)字典文檔,包括 3 方面內(nèi)容: (1)數(shù)據(jù)項(xiàng)。 (3)數(shù)據(jù)流。 (2)圖書借閱 信息。 數(shù)據(jù)庫邏輯結(jié)構(gòu)設(shè)計(jì) 概念結(jié)構(gòu)是獨(dú)立于實(shí)際數(shù)據(jù)模型的信息 結(jié)構(gòu),必須將其轉(zhuǎn)化為邏輯結(jié)構(gòu)后才能進(jìn)行數(shù)據(jù)庫應(yīng)用的設(shè)計(jì)。 通過用戶表查閱用戶權(quán)限和借閱證號(hào) , 判斷是否是管理員 , 是否擁有 修改圖書和用戶信息 的權(quán) 限 。 通過 圖 書借閱信息表可以獲取圖書借閱的信息。用于顯示數(shù)據(jù)和接收用戶輸入的數(shù)據(jù),為用戶提供一種交互式操作的界面。 數(shù)據(jù)訪問層類設(shè)計(jì)與實(shí)現(xiàn) 數(shù)據(jù)訪問層( BookDAL):該層所做事務(wù)直接操作數(shù)據(jù)庫,針對(duì)數(shù)據(jù)的增添、刪除、修 改、更新、查找等。Integrated Security=True。 } else if ( == || == ) { ()。 = strsql。 try { CreateConnection()。 return i。 SqlCommand sqlcmd = new SqlCommand(strsql, sqlcon)。 return i。 DataSet ds = new DataSet()。 } } public static DataSet GetDataSet(string strsql, params SqlParameter[] param) { CreateConnection()。 } try { (ds)。 SqlDataAdapter sda = new SqlDataAdapter(strsql, sqlcon)。 return [temp]。 SqlDataAdapter sda = new SqlDataAdapter(strsql, sqlcon)。 ()。 + + 39。% + + %39。 } public DataTable QuarryAll() { string str = select * from BookInfo。 return (str,param)。 + id + 39。 int i = (str, parm)。 int i = (str, parm)。 int i = (str, parm)。 int i = (str)。 return (str, param)。如果在分層設(shè)計(jì)時(shí),遵循了面向接口設(shè)計(jì)的思想,那么這種向下的依賴也應(yīng)該是一種弱依賴關(guān)系。 本管理系統(tǒng)創(chuàng)建 BookMessage、 UserMessage 兩個(gè)類,實(shí)現(xiàn)數(shù)基于 C的圖書館管理系統(tǒng) 據(jù)訪問層和用戶訪問層之間的數(shù)據(jù)傳遞。 登錄界面 如圖所示 : 基于 C的圖書館管理系統(tǒng) 主界面及代
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號(hào)-1